## Parcel Webhook Env Vars

Heads up, reviewer: the Trundle parcel-tracking webhook reads WEBHOOK_RETRY_MAX and WEBHOOK_TIMEOUT_MS from this file. Retries are capped at five because the carrier sandbox gets grumpy otherwise. Payload signatures are verified on every delivery, and the shared signing secret that makes that work is set on the next line.

sealed setting: ARCHIVE_KEY3=8d0

### Action Item: Spoolhaven Retry Storm

From last Tuesday's outage: the Spoolhaven print service retried failed jobs without backoff, saturating the render pool. Fix merged; retries now use capped exponential backoff with jitter. Owner will monitor for a week before closing. The agreed retry constants are recorded below.

constants for yadup-kajof:
RATE_LIMITS = {
    "zorwyn": 1,
    "druwyn": 1,
}

## Archiving cold storage buckets

When a customer's retention window lapses, the Hollowgrange archiver moves their cold bucket to glacier tier automatically. Support should not trigger archives manually; instead, verify the bucket shows status ARCHIVED in the admin panel after the nightly run. Restores take up to 12 hours and require a ticket to platform. The archiver runs on each region with the settings below.

settings of kajep-kawip:
[zorys]
host = zorys.urlaqgrid.corp
user = zorys_svc
database = zorys_prod